Hey all,

I've been using the Precision Pro R1, which i have loved.  The price-point, accuracy and additional data this rangefinder provides are exceptional.  The downside?  I have to plug it in to recharge every two rounds vs. carrying an extra battery in my bag as needed for most rangefinders.

At the $300 price point, you can't beat it.  Anyone else have good recommendations for rangefinders?  I love the idea of the Cube rangefinder, but again, it's a rechargeable battery.

I tested the Precision Pro NX10 for the forum back in 2022 and it's been great for me.  The extra battery isn't a huge deal.  I'm not 100% certain but I think I'm on my 2nd battery now so I got well over a year on the first one and the shelf life on them is several years so easy to keep in the bag.  Also, the battery indicator is pretty accurate so it won't surprise you and just stop working.

You can find a Bushnell second hand for a really good price many times on FB Marketplace or EBay. I bought my V5 on sale with the X3 model came out last year for under $400. I don’t think you have to overspend in order to get good quality in a range finder. I know Blue Tees makes a good one too.

I checked my Precision Pro NX7 with slope against an expensive unit I use for hunting (Leica) and it was dead on.  It locks on to the pin easy and does everything I need on the course for relatively cheap.

I bought mine from Costco.  Paid around $130 for it and it seems to work just fine for me.  It has the slope on/off feature.  I carry an extra batter in my bag just in case.  

But this thread got me thinking, what makes a high end rangefinder better than a low end (assuming both are accurate +/- a yard or two)?  Am I missing something the $400 rangefinders offer that mine doesn't?  I've stood on tee boxes with other people that use other rangefinders and there is never more than a yard or two difference.
